The Bowlero - San Diego, CA - Vintage Bowling Alley - Long Sleeve T-Shirt wolf Lee was a landlocked riverboatBowlero stood tall on Camino Del Rio in San Diego, a mid century landmark boasting 56 lanes with automatic pinsetters. Opening in the late 1950s, it arrived when bowling was becoming America's favorite pastime. Places like this gave working families a night out and neighborhoods a gathering place.
